Like other Sawday guides, this book is about people, for it is the people who mould the amazing houses in which you’ll stay, and whose characters, eccentricities and generosity will make your holiday special. There’s a huge variety to chose from, from tiny pigeonniers and medieval watch-towers for two, to sumptuous châteaux (one with a four-poster bath!), and water mills where running rivers will lull you to sleep. There are stone farmhouses where you can walk out of the front door and into the mountains, village houses tucked under the ramparts, and chic city apartments from where you can stroll to some of France’s finest restaurants. Whatever you are looking for, more likely than not it will be within these pages.

Vast or small – we have ski chalets and sumptuous châteaux, a pigeonnier, an old convent, a bakery, a 30s Riviera villa…

We have visited every entry and write our own prose. Each place is here because we like it and many cost under €150 per person per week

Imagine… roll-topped baths, open fires, saltwater pools, local markets, fresh mussels, family dinner in the orchard. And, sometimes, meals cooked just for you

These places take special care of people, and we try to take care of the environment – with ‘green’ and social policies, and an eco-office
